Biography

I graduated from Texas A&M University with a Bachelor of Science in Entomology in 2009.

I immediately started in the pest control industry with a position in distribution where I started working for Target Specialty Products. Initially, I was a branch manager where I was tasked with managing inventory, employees and the safety of our team and fleet. Because of this experience I can understand the importance of the branch and service manager’s role here at Hawx Smart Pest Control. More recently with Target, spanning the last 7 years, I focused on industry trainings and hosting CEU courses for pest control companies throughout Texas. By doing so, I have built relationships within the pest control industry with various persons within academia and manufacturers. I have been able to represent distribution in a host of different conventions and was active in my local Texas Pest Control Chapters to help support pest control laws and regulations to ensure pest control is here to stay and to keep employees and PMP’s safe as well as our clients.

I have carried a Certified Applicator’s license in the state of Texas since 2015 and since then have been a certified trainer within the state. I have hosted many technician trainings which is a requirement for pest management professionals. I really enjoy and pride myself on getting apprentices ready for their exams to become certified technicians here in the state of Texas.

I am excited to be part of the Hawx team where I can bring my prior experience and industry relationships from distribution to educate and train our team locally on protocols, products and safety.
